Hi, my son is 6 months old, and it seams to me like it’s time to start a solid diet. However, I don’t want to do something stupid, so please tell me what is the perfect time for starting with solid food? Is he still too young?

Hi, the perfect time for starting a solid food depends on the baby, but it usually happens between 4 and 6 month. When the right moment comes, your son will still be hungry even when he gets enough milk. When that happens, you will know that you can start with a solid food. However, you can’t give him any solid food right away. Start with rice cereal, because it is the best for your son’s digestive system at this moment. Most parents choose a dinnertime for solid diet, because this way, baby won’t be hungry over night. He must be sitting when you’re feeding him, don’t do that while he’s lying. If your son refuses solid food, don’t force him to eat it and continue with bottle feeding.
